Mostrar los tags: informatica

Mostrando del 1 al 4 de 4 coincidencias
<<>>
Se ha buscado por el tag: informatica
Imágen de perfil

Contenido en LWPTutorial completo SHA256 explicado paso a paso (incluye 224, 384, 512)


C sharp

,

Criptografia

Actualizado el 22 de Noviembre del 2021 por Pere (Publicado el 19 de Noviembre del 2021)
4.119 visualizaciones desde el 19 de Noviembre del 2021
Hola, soy Pere Rovira y os presento este vídeo-tutorial que muestra paso a paso cómo funciona el algoritmo SHA-256.

Esta guía es para todas las personas que sientan interés por el algoritmo y tengan nociones básicas o nulas sobre programación y matemáticas. Utilizaré un lenguaje sencillo para que nadie se quede atrás y el tutorial esté al alcance de todos.

SHA-256 no es un secreto y su funcionamiento ya es conocido, pero su documentación es muy técnica, y cuando gente curiosa o ajena a la criptografía y a la programación se topa con ella… tiende a dejarlo para otro día o quizá sólo logra pillar un par de conceptos. No es que la documentación esté mal, ¡sólo faltaría!, pero a veces va bien una mano amiga que nos ayude a traducir esos tecnicismos en un lenguaje más común.

El vídeo-tutorial consta de varios capítulos que explican con ejemplos prácticos todos los elementos y procesos que lo componen. Mientras avancemos, iré haciendo pequeñas anotaciones sobre algunos conceptos para que el tutorial sea fluido y lineal. Finalmente seréis capaces de desarrollar los demás algoritmos de la família SHA-2

Aquí tenéis un índice del vídeo entero:
1. Introducción.
2. Qué es SHA-256.
3. Representación del Hash.
4. Finalidad del Hash.
5. 256 Bits.
6. Conversión Hexadecimal.
7. Suma Módulo 2^32.
8. Codificación.
9. Operadores Bitwise.
10. Inicalizar el mensaje.
11. Matriz W[ ].
12. Inicializar matrices H[ ] y K[ ].
13. Compresión.
14. C# Funciones básicas.
15. C# Esquema del código.
16. C# Desarrollar SHA-256.
17. C# SHA-224, SHA-384, SHA-512.
18. Bibliografía.

Sería chulo que al final fueseis capaces de leer la documentación técnica de otra manera, entendiendo y analizando detalles que antes se os pasaban por alto. O simplemente que asome la curiosidad y os lancéis a estudiar documentación especializada para redondear vuestros conocimientos.

Mi principal compromiso con este vídeo-tutorial es para aquellas personas con nulo o muy básico conocimiento en programación y criptografía. Creo que el conocimiento debe ser accesible a todo el mundo, pero también la forma de darlo.

Si usáis este tutorial para transmitir conocimientos, os agradecería que citaseis y mantuvierais la fuente, así como la bibliografía que he usado.

Muchas gracias.
¡Hasta pronto!

--------------------
Lista de reproducción
Tutorial completo SHA256 explicado paso a paso (incluye 224, 384, 512)

--------------------
Mi canal: Pere Rovira - Tutoriales


--------------------
Bibliografía:
Aquí os dejo la bibliografía:
FIBS PUB 180-4
FIPS 180-4
Descriptions of SHA256, SHA384 and SHA512
SHA512/256
SHA-2 (Wikipedia)
How Does SHA-256 Work? (learnmeabitcoin)
How SHA-256 Works Step-By-Step (Lane Wagner)
4.294.967.295 (Wikipedia)
Rotate bits of a number (GeeksForGeeks)
Bitwise (Khan Academy)
Suma modular (Khan Academy)
Crypto Stackexchange
Excepciones III (PíldorasInformáticas)
SHA256 OnLine
Imágen de perfil

.pdfIntroducción a la Informática


General

,

Office

,

Hardware

Publicado el 12 de Enero del 2020 por Administrador
3.297 visualizaciones desde el 12 de Enero del 2020
Índice de Contenidos:
0.- Fundamentos
1.- La computadora en la actualidad: Del cálculo a la conexión
2.- Fundamentos del hardware: Dentro de la caja
3.- Fundamentos del hardware: Periféficos
4.- Fundamenos del software: El fanstamsa de la máquina
5.- Aplicaciones ofimáticas básicas
6.- Gráficos, medios digitales y multimedia
7.- Aplicaciones e implicaciones de las bases de datos
8.- Redes y telecomunicaciones
9.- Dentro de Internet y la World Wide Web
10.- Seguridad y riesgos de la computadora
11.- Computadoras en el trabajo, el colegio y el hogar
12.- Sistemas de información en la empresa
13.- Comercio electrónico y e-bussines
14.- Diseño y desarrollo de sistemas
15.- ¿Es real la inteligencia artificial?
Apéndice
Glosario
Créditos de las fotografías
Índice analítico

En formato pdf. Contiene 660 páginas.

Screenshot_20200112_184533
Imágen de perfil

.pdfHerramientas para principiantes TIC


General

Publicado el 23 de Mayo del 2019 por Administrador
1.343 visualizaciones desde el 23 de Mayo del 2019
Guía de introducción básica para principiantes. Repasa los aspectos más básicos de la informática a nivel usuario.

Índice de Contenidos:
1.- Introducción
2.- Introducción a Windows
3.- Trabajar con aplicaciones
4.- El explorador de archivos
5.- Navegar por Internet
6.- Correo electrónico
7.- Teléfono por Internet (Skype)
8.- Redes Sociales I (Facebook)
9.- Redes Sociales II (Twitter)
10.- Windows 8

En formato pdf. Contiene 96 páginas.

Screenshot_20190523_223655
Imágen de perfil

.pdfGuía del taller de iniciación a la informática


General

Publicado el 14 de Enero del 2019 por Administrador
1.776 visualizaciones desde el 14 de Enero del 2019
Guía de introducción a la informática.

Índice de Contenidos:
Presentación
Prólogo
1. Conocer el ordenador
¿Qué es la informática?
¿Qué es un ordenador?
El hardware y el software
Los periféricos: entrada, salida y entrada/salida
El funcionamiento del ratón
El funcionamiento del teclado
Conectemos el ordenador y sus ele
Encendamos y apaguemos el ordenador
2. Introducción a Windows (I)
¿Qué es Windows?
El escritorio
Menú de inicio
Los accesorios
Las ventanas: abrir, minimizar, maximizar, restaurar y cerrar
Mover ventanas y cambiar su tamaño
3. Adaptar el ordenador
El panel de control
La fecha y la hora
La pantalla
El ratón
El volumen
4. Introducción a Windows (II)
Archivos: programas y documentos
Trabajar con los iconos
Ejercicio
5. Organizar la información
El explorador de Windows
Gestión de carpetas y archivos
La papelera de reciclaje
6. WordPad y la pantalla principal
Abrir el programa WordPad
La interfaz gráfica
La barra de menús
La barra de botones
Escribir en el programa WordPad
7. Crear nuestro primer documento
Crear un documento con WordPad
Guardar, guardar como y abrir documentos
Las presentaciones
8. La impresión, la calculadora y otras herramientas
Impresión con WordPad
Practiquemos con el teclado y el ratón
9. Dibujar con el ordenador (I)
Funcionamiento básico del programa Paint
Dibujar en el programa Paint
10. Dibujar con el ordenador (II)
Guardar, guardar como y abrir dibujos
Impresión con Paint
Ejercicio libre con Paint
11. Otros periféricos y curiosidades
El módem, la cámara digital y el escáner
Los lectores de tarjetas
Las memorias externas USB
La cámara web y el micrófono
Lista de las combinaciones de teclas más habituales
12. Ejercicio final
Repaso general

En formato pdf. Contiene 258 páginas.